Essential Tools for Cupcake Decoration Basic Tools You Need Before starting, make sure you have these essentials: Piping bags: Disposable or reusable for precise designs. Piping tips: Star, round, and petal tips cover most designs. Spatula/knife: For smoothing frosting or dome-style cupcakes. Turntable (optional): Helps rotate cupcakes while piping intricate designs. Having the right tools makes your cupcake decoration techniques easier and more accurate. Types of Piping Tips Explained Understanding piping tips is critical: Open Star: Perfect for swirls, rosettes, and ruffles. Closed Star: Creates defined ridges for flowers. Round Tip: Ideal for dots, lines, and lettering. Petal Tip: For delicate petals and advanced floral designs. Choosing the right tip ensures your designs are clean and professional. Preparing the Perfect Cupcake Base Even Baking Tips A flawless cupcake begins with a flat, even base: Use the same amount of batter in each cup. Bake evenly to prevent domed tops, which interfere with frosting. Flat tops make cupcake decoration techniques like swirls and rosettes much easier. Frosting Consistency Guide Frosting consistency is often overlooked: Too soft: Melts or loses shape. Too stiff: Difficult to pipe and may tear your bag. Perfect consistency is key for smooth execution of cupcake decoration techniques. Step-by-Step Cupcake Decorating Process Step 1 – Fill the Piping Bag Fold the bag over your hand or cup, and spoon in frosting carefully. Avoid overfilling; half-full bags are easier to control. Step 2 – Hold the Bag Correctly Grip firmly at the top, guide the tip with your dominant hand, and support the bag with the other if necessary Step 3 – Apply Pressure Evenly Consistent pressure ensures smooth swirls. Uneven pressure leads to lopsided designs. Step 4 – Start from Center or Edge Center start: Ideal for classic swirls and rosettes. Edge start: Works best for layered, ruffle, or petal designs. Mastering these steps lays the foundation for advanced cupcake decoration techniques. 10 Easy Cupcake Decoration Techniques 1. Classic Swirl Use an open star tip, apply even pressure, and rotate from the center. Simple, elegant, and timeless. 2. Rosette Design Start at the center and pipe outward in a circular motion. Perfect for weddings or birthdays. 3. Ruffle Style Move the tip back and forth for textured ruffles. Adds visual interest to your cupcakes. 4. Smooth Dome Use a spatula or knife to create a smooth frosting dome. Minimalist yet stylish. 5. Star Drop Technique Pipe small star shapes with a star tip. Quick and versatile for filling space. 6. Two-Tone Frosting Fill your bag with two colors to create gradient effects. Eye-catching and fun. 7. Spoon Texture Design Use a spoon to create waves or peaks in frosting. Simple but striking. 8. Drip + Toppings Style Drip chocolate or ganache, then add sprinkles or candy. Adds a professional bakery touch. 9. Sprinkle Explosion Use colorful sprinkles, sugar pearls, or edible glitter. Great for kids’ parties. 10. Minimalist Flat Frosting Smooth frosting with a spatula and add a single garnish. Elegant and modern. Common Cupcake Decorating Mistakes to Avoid Overfilling piping bags Uneven frosting consistency Incorrect piping angle or start point Skipping practice – repetition is essential Avoiding these mistakes ensures your cupcake decoration techniques are consistently successful. Pro Tips to Make Your Cupcakes Look Bakery-Style Use high-quality butter for smoother frosting. Chill cupcakes slightly before decorating. Work on a stable surface to prevent shaking. Test your designs on a small cupcake first. Highlight designs with contrasting decorations. Following these tips guarantees cupcakes that look professional and polished.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) What is the easiest way to decorate cupcakes? Classic swirls with an open star tip are the simplest and fastest way to make cupcakes look polished. Which piping tip is best for beginners? A large open star tip (Wilton 1M) is versatile and forgiving. How do you make cupcakes look professional? Even baking, smooth frosting, controlled piping, and creative toppers are essential. Can I decorate cupcakes without piping tools? Yes.
